ホームページ > バックエンド開発 > Python チュートリアル > Pandas DataFrame で文字列列を Datetime に変換するにはどうすればよいですか?

Pandas DataFrame で文字列列を Datetime に変換するにはどうすればよいですか?

DDD
リリース: 2024-12-08 18:44:11
オリジナル
214 人が閲覧しました

How Can I Convert a String Column to Datetime in a Pandas DataFrame?

DataFrame の文字列列を日時形式に変換します

問題:

列をどのように変換できますかDataFrame 内の文字列をさらに分析するために datetime dtype に変換するか、操作?

答え:

to_datetime 関数は、日付を表す文字列を datetime オブジェクトに変換する簡単な方法を提供します。目的の列に適用することで、効率的に変換を行うことができます。

df['column_name'] = pd.to_datetime(df['column_name'])
ログイン後にコピー

引数:

  • column_name: 文字列を含む列の名前日付。

オプション引数:

  • format: 解析に必要な日付形式を指定します。

補足:

  • デフォルトの形式 (%Y-%m-%d) を使用する場合、dayfirst 引数を True に設定できます。文字列内で日が月の前にあるシナリオ。
  • 例:
df['date_column'] = pd.to_datetime(df['date_column'], format='%d/%m/%Y')
ログイン後にコピー

これは、「dd/mm/yyyy」形式の文字列を、 DataFrame により、日付関連の操作を簡単に処理できるようになります。

以上がPandas DataFrame で文字列列を Datetime に変換する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ート